Ancient DNA offers hope for California's critically endangered black abalone

Ancient DNA offers hope for California's critically endangered black abalone Lisa Lock Scientific Editor Robert Egan Associate Editor Black abalone once carpeted the rocky shores of California by the millions. The large, long-lived sea snails sustained Indigenous peoples along the coast for thousands of years, anchored a thriving 20th-century commercial fishery and inspired generations of California cooks, divers, and artists. Then, almost overnight, they vanished.
